Roche inaugurates health journalist academy in Nigeria

Multinational Swiss pharmaceutical company Roche has inaugurated the Health Journalists Academy, the first ever academy in Nigeria, aimed at training health reporters selected from both the print and electronic media. The unveiling of the first 15 recipients is ongoing at Wheatbaker Hotel, Ikoyi, Lagos. More to come.
